[ovs-git] [openvswitch/ovs] d273f0: datapath: STT: Fix checksum handling.

GitHub noreply at github.com
Fri Mar 4 00:17:56 UTC 2016


  Branch: refs/heads/branch-2.5
  Home:   https://github.com/openvswitch/ovs
  Commit: d273f03533d62eab41479f01804e6b00910cfb5e
      https://github.com/openvswitch/ovs/commit/d273f03533d62eab41479f01804e6b00910cfb5e
  Author: Pravin B Shelar <pshelar at ovn.org>
  Date:   2016-03-03 (Thu, 03 Mar 2016)

  Changed paths:
    M datapath/linux/compat/stt.c

  Log Message:
  -----------
  datapath: STT: Fix checksum handling.

On packet receive STT verifies the checksum if not done in
hardware. But IP and TCP were pulled before the verification
step. The verification expect to see packet with TCP header.
This causes STT to drop packet in certain cases.

Signed-off-by: Pravin B Shelar <pshelar at ovn.org>
Acked-by: Joe Stringer <joe at ovn.org>




More information about the git mailing list